How Often Should You Change Your Oil?
How often should car owners be changing their oil? This question often arises among car enthusiasts and everyday drivers alike. Generally, manufacturers recommend changing engine oil every 5,000 to 7,500 miles, although some modern vehicles can stretch this interval to 10,000 miles or more under specific conditions. Factors influencing oil change frequency include driving habits, climate, and the type of oil used. To illustrate, individuals who commonly deal with congested roadways or travel through severe temperature fluctuations may find themselves needing oil changes more regularly. Moreover, synthetic motor oils are known to deliver enhanced protection and can help lengthen the duration between necessary oil changes. Regularly checking the oil level and its overall quality is critical; oil that appears dark and contains grit is a clear sign that a change is overdue. In the end, sticking to a consistent oil change routine is crucial for preserving engine integrity, maximizing vehicle performance, and extending the life of your car, making it a fundamental element of conscientious vehicle ownership.
What Does a Full Service Oil Change Include?
A thorough full oil change typically encompasses multiple critical aspects designed to guarantee peak engine performance. To begin, the process consists of extracting the aged engine oil, which is subsequently substituted with premium, manufacturer-approved oil. The oil filter is also replaced to make certain that contaminants do not circulate within the engine.
Alongside these primary tasks, service professionals typically carry out a comprehensive multi-point check, assessing hoses, belts, and fluid levels for deterioration and damage. They will also examine the cabin filter and air filter, replacing them if necessary.
A number of auto shops supply extra services, such as tire rotation, brake examination, and even a wash or vacuum of the car's interior, elevating the overall upkeep of the vehicle. This comprehensive strategy not only sustains the health of the engine but also supports the lifespan of additional vital systems within the vehicle.

Knowing When to Book Your Next Complete Oil Change Service
When should vehicle owners consider scheduling their next full service oil change? As a general rule, service intervals fall between 3,000 and 7,500 miles, influenced by the vehicle's make, model, and the variety of oil being used. Keeping a close eye on the vehicle's oil level and condition is critical; should the oil look dark or gritty, this could signal that a change is needed ahead of schedule. Additionally, owners should take note of the vehicle's performance. Odd noises, lower fuel economy, or illuminated dashboard lights may be signs that an oil change is overdue. Shifting seasons may also affect the recommended oil change schedule; as an example, severe winter conditions may require more regular oil changes. In closing, reviewing the owner's manual delivers personalized guidance suited to the vehicle, promoting top performance and durability. Routine oil change appointments are a forward-thinking approach to keeping the engine in good shape and steering clear of high-cost repairs later on.
Answers to Your Most Common Questions
Can Additional Services Be Performed During a Full Service Oil Change?
Indeed, most automotive centers provide additional services during a complete oil change service. These often include rotating your tires, fluid level inspections, and air filter changes, giving you a practical chance for comprehensive car maintenance in a single visit.
What Kind of Oil Is Used in a Full Service Oil Change?
Generally, a standard oil change uses either standard, blended synthetic, or full synthetic oil. The selection is determined by the automobile's needs and the owner's needs, ensuring optimal performance and engine preservation during use.
How Long Does a Full Service Oil Change Take?
A full service oil change generally needs between half an hour to an hour, depending on the facility's efficiency and additional services requested. Factors like the type of vehicle and selected oil can additionally impact the duration.
Do I Need to Schedule an Appointment for a Full Service Oil Change?
An appointment for a full service oil change is typically recommended, ensuring the service center can accommodate the vehicle promptly. That said, many service centers also accommodate walk-in visits, providing flexibility for those with immediate needs.
Are Full Service Oil Changes Pricier Than Standard Oil Changes?
Comprehensive oil changes typically cost more than basic oil changes owing to the supplementary services they encompass, like fluid checks and filter replacements. This higher price reflects the complete maintenance performed on your vehicle's upkeep.
